Former Belfast media headquarters to make way for student housing development
Plans for a new £55m purpose built student accommodation development in Belfast city centre have been submitted. Property development company South Bank Square has confirmed that it has submitted a planning application for the major purpose-built student accommodation at Fanum House.

Plans to demolish former Glasgow bank and bar to build 173 student flats
Plans to demolish a former city centre bank and a bar to build 173 student flats have been recommended for approval next week. Caledon Properties Ltd initially got permission to build a hotel on the site, at the corner of Trongate and Hutcheson Street, but have changed the proposal to student accommodation.
Approval tipped for redevelopment of former Barker and Stonehouse site
Plans to transform the site of a former Barker & Stonehouse showroom in Newcastle into student accommodation look set for approval. The application relates to a 0.7-acre site on Leazes Park Road which is occupied by the retailer as well as Strawberry House.
Harrison Street Gets $25M Refi for NY Student Community
Harrison Street has refinanced Twin River Commons, a 127-unit, 371-bed luxury student housing community in Binghamton, N.Y. TSB Capital Advisors arranged the floating-rate loan.
Brookfield denies sale of Iberian student housing portfolio
Canadian investment firm Brookfield has denied reports of a possible sale of Livensa Living, a student housing company with 22 assets in Spain and Portugal, offering over 8,000 beds.

Warwick University aims to boost student bed spaces by over 1,000 in next decade
Warwick University is predicting student numbers will rise by 2033. It hopes to boost housing on or near campus to the tune of some 1,200 student beds by this point, according to new plans. The schemes would be developed by the university directly or working with private companies.
